Simplicial and Topological Descriptions of Human Brain Dynamics

2020-09-09

Abstract excerpt

<h4>ABSTRACT</h4> Whereas brain imaging tools like functional Magnetic Resonance Imaging (fMRI) afford measurements of whole-brain activity, it remains unclear how best to interpret patterns found amid the data’s apparent self-organization. To clarify how patterns of brain activity support brain function, one might identify metric spaces that optimally distinguish brain states across experimentally defined condit...
